On-call note — Skiff session-token refresh bug. Tokens issued by the Skiff gateway fail silent refresh after 55 minutes, logging users out mid-session. Workaround: restart the token-mint pod, then clear the refresh queue. If the mint's keystore locks during restart, use the recovery flow; the passphrase for it appears below.

strongbox words: sorir-belvan-rusix-ulays-ralmir-praix-eliir-tamax-praael-druael-julir-tamius-jorir

## Break-Glass Access: Datefmt Service

If the Calfour localization pipeline drops the ball on date formats again (looking at you, week-numbering locales), you may need emergency access to push a hotfix to the datefmt rules bundle. Break-glass is logged and pages the on-call, so don't be shy but don't be casual either. To unlock the emergency deploy vault, use the recovery passphrase below.

recovery phrase for fawef-tagug: silath-novwyn-holax-praius-quenys-ralok-ralmir-silath-gilmir

## Runbook: PacketWarden Typo-Squat Scanner

Before publishing a plugin to the Lorelix registry, run the PacketWarden scanner against your package name. It compares your name against the full registry index using edit-distance and homoglyph checks, and flags any candidate within two substitutions of an existing popular package. Review every flag carefully; false positives must be dismissed with a written justification in the manifest. The current threshold configuration and dismissal policy are documented on the internal page below.

dashboard of fadup-yahif = https://confluence.zemvarlabs.internal/display/browse/browse/display/9c97

**Mgmt Meeting Minutes — Retiring the Brightline Range**

Quick recap for sales leads at Fenholt Supplies: we agreed to retire the Brightline fixture range by year-end. Remaining stock moves to clearance pricing next month, and accounts on standing orders get migrated to the Lumetta range. Trade-in incentives were approved in principle. The confidential note on next steps sits just below.

board note of bajof-bajeg: The pricing group signed off on a budget of $13.4 million for Project Sildor. The renewal with Lamixek Holdings closes at $48.9 million a year, 49 percent above the last contract.